RapidShare Not Liable For Pirating Users, Court Rules

Posted: 04 May 2010 03:00 PM PDT

RapidShare is not liable for acts of copyright infringement committed by its users, a German court ruled yesterday. The Dusseldorf Court of Appeals overturned the earlier decision of a local district court in a case brought by the movie outfit Capelight Pictures.

Bald Eagles May Have to Eat Toxic Seals

Posted: 04 May 2010 12:20 PM PDT

Bald eagle numbers are growing on California's Channel Islands and that might not be entirely good news, a new study suggests. To make ends meet, the predatory birds may be forced to scavenge on marine mammal carcasses, the blubber of which is still laced with DDT-the same pesticide that infamously led to the near extinction of bald eagles...

Nintendo Profits Declining for First Time Since 2004

Posted: 04 May 2010 12:10 PM PDT

For the first time since the DS launch in 2004, Nintendo is forecasting a drop in profits for the fiscal year ending in March 2010. Reports say that the company will report 230 billion yen ($2.4 billion) in profits, down from 279.1 billion ($2.95 billion) the prior year.
